Does anyone know where I can buy tichels, and are there any tutorials on how to tie them nicely? What kind of hats look nice? I don’t really like Yemima Mizrachi’s hats (Although I absolutely love her)


I don’t know if it’s in style (and I don’t care), but I oftentimes wear a beanie with my hair in. I use a wig grip to keep it in place (I can also perfect my hair better in the front with a grip). I use a grip for anything I wear, including scarves. Everything stays neat this way.
